Output 3ef29495384770c5676bef29327f9cda2f3d69869bf32b7138fdac95fefe4b0a:3

value
31032385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d2c3e9641ddcfdc8eb72e8917a1d98cb9e20090 OP_EQUAL
address
MGPp5RwTXg5CA71AhiDZbqbVkaDXFmFG5b
transaction
3ef29495384770c5676bef29327f9cda2f3d69869bf32b7138fdac95fefe4b0a
spent
true